
Casey Mines
Dr. Casey Mines is a former physician and wellness influencer who has gained recognition for her holistic approach to health. A Stanford University medical school graduate, she left her surgical residency due to disillusionment with traditional healthcare practices. Instead, she became a prominent figure in the wellness movement, founding the medical technology company Levels, which focuses on blood sugar monitoring and other health metrics. Mines has also built a significant social media following, promoting various health products. In 2024, she co-authored the book 'Good Energy' with her brother, Kali Mines, addressing the epidemic of chronic diseases linked to corporate corruption and lifestyle choices. Recently, she was nominated by former President Donald Trump to serve as the U.S. Surgeon General, a role that would position her as a key figure in public health.
